vortex cloud system

简明释义

涡旋云系

英英释义

A vortex cloud system refers to a meteorological phenomenon characterized by rotating columns of air that create distinct cloud formations, often associated with severe weather conditions such as thunderstorms or tornadoes.

In recent years, the study of atmospheric phenomena has gained significant attention, particularly with the advent of advanced meteorological technologies. One of the most intriguing concepts in this field is the vortex cloud system, which refers to a type of cloud formation characterized by rotating air masses that create a distinct spiral pattern. Understanding this phenomenon is crucial for predicting severe weather events and comprehending the dynamics of our atmosphere.The vortex cloud system typically forms when warm, moist air rises and interacts with cooler air layers above. This interaction can lead to the development of a low-pressure area, which causes the surrounding air to rotate around it. As this rotation intensifies, it can lead to the formation of various types of clouds, including cumulonimbus clouds, which are often associated with thunderstorms. These clouds can produce heavy rainfall, lightning, and even tornadoes, making the study of the vortex cloud system essential for weather forecasting.One of the fascinating aspects of the vortex cloud system is its ability to influence local weather patterns. For instance, when a vortex cloud system develops over a region, it can lead to significant changes in temperature and humidity levels. This can result in sudden storms or prolonged periods of dry weather, depending on the system's movement and strength. Meteorologists use various tools, such as satellite imagery and radar, to track these systems and provide timely warnings to affected areas.Moreover, the vortex cloud system is not just limited to severe weather; it also plays a role in the overall climate system. The rotation of these cloud formations can affect ocean currents and wind patterns, which are critical components of the Earth's climate.
